系统需求分析.doc

上传人:asd****56 文档编号:69683128 上传时间:2023-01-07 格式:DOC 页数:8 大小:90KB
返回 下载 相关 举报
系统需求分析.doc_第1页
第1页 / 共8页
系统需求分析.doc_第2页
第2页 / 共8页
点击查看更多>>
资源描述

《系统需求分析.doc》由会员分享,可在线阅读,更多相关《系统需求分析.doc(8页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。

1、1 系统需求分析1.1 课题背景介绍与意义随着超市里货物种类和数量的大量增加,超市工作人员的工作量也随之增多,然而,日益繁重的工作使同志们日益疲惫,每位同志都在超负荷的运转,为出现工作失误制造了一定的有利条件,对于此,超市的管理层看在眼里,急在心理。怎样既可加快办事效率,又能减少工作失误,更好服务于社会主义四个现代化建设的问题,逐渐的进入到了领导的视线里,经过同志们以三个代表为指导思想,同心同德,集思广益,最终,在超市领导深思熟虑后果断决定近期上马一套为本超市量身定做的管理软件,它的上马将大大的提升本超市的工作管理水平,使员工们能更好的投入到工作中去。1.1.1 背景介绍进销存管理系统是一个典

2、型的信息管理系统,其开发主要包括后台数据库的建立和维护以及前端界面程序的开发两个方面。进销存管理系统在设计上体现了人性化和“以人为本”的精神。界面设计上亲切友好,简单直观,便于操作。系统的核心是进货、销售和库存三者之间的联系,每一个表的修改都将会牵扯到其它的表,当完成进货、销售和退货操作时系统会自动地完成相对应信息的修改。查询功能也是系统的核心之一,在系统中可以进行模糊查询和精确查询,其目的都是为了方便用户使用,以求更快的查找到相应的基本信息。利用超市管理系统可以在以下几个方面提高超市管理的水平:提高管理效率提高销售额降低人工成本降低采购成本商业数据智能分析高效决策1.1.2 研究意义本文将着

3、眼于以下两个方面:分析管理中的进销存三方面的业务:针对目前物资销售现状及市场调研,绘制各种图例,包括数据流图(DFD):顶层数据流图和一级细化图设计出进销存管理系统的原型,解决以往进销存信息管理系统功能不完善、不稳定、远程通信能力差以及企业进、销、存信息脱节等问题,为用的单位提供一个高效、方便的进销存信息管理平台。本文的具体内容如下:(1) 通过对市场进行调查,研究了物资产品经营过程中进、销、存等重要环节,对系统进行规划,分析了系统将要实现的基本信息管理、商品到货入库管理、商品销售管理、库存管理等、报表打印功能,绘制各种图例,确定其基本结构及实现策略。(2) 数据库访问技术和jsp技术,str

4、ust2,hibernaet技术等等(3) 还有研究了、库存、供应商、客户的数据,根据数据之间的联系,建立数据库的输入、输出、管理等模。(4) 通过MySql数据库访问技术和jsp编码技术等实现进销存管理系统原型的设计与应用。1.2 国内外现状分析大大提高超市的运作效率,通过全面的信息采集和处理,辅助提高超市的决策水平;使用本系统,可以迅速提升超市的管理水平,为降低经营成本,提高效益,增强超市扩张力,提供有效的技术保障。要求系统能有效、快速、安全、可靠和无误的完成上述操作。并要求客户机的界面要单明了,易于操作,服务器程序利于维护。1.3 问题提出传统的信息传递和管理方式不仅效率低,可靠性、安全

5、性和保密性也无法满足要求,而且数据统计时间严重滞后,往往是当领导了解到企业的 “进、销、存”出现问时,早已产生了严重的后果。即使是没有分公司的企业,使用传统的手工放肆管理也存在同样的问题:信息化不足,计算机使用率低,大量的日常工作皆是手工处理,导致工作效率低落,企业内部沟通不良等等问题很难克服,仓库管理很不合理,不能及时根据需要调整库存。而且在手工管理的情况下,销售人员很难对客户做出正确的供货承诺,同时企业的生产部门也缺少一份准确的生产计划,目前的生产状况和市场的需求很难正确反映到生产中去。这在激烈的市场中是非常不利解决的问题是: 1缺少一个集成的信息平台和信息系统,而各个业务部门之间缺少信息

6、沟通(即重复劳动)和共享是传统库存管理中资金占用过大的主要原因之一。 2解决企业内部统一的物料编码管理,物流管理中的信息流通。库存积压与物料的配套问题。3销售部门能方便地根据预测信息、各仓库的库存信息和客户的要货情况作出货物的调拨计划和改制计1.4可行性分析1. 从技术角度分析,这项开发工作所涉及的专业技术为:Java编程技术、J2SE、MySQL、JDBC。由于开发中涉及MySQL的应用,所以最好使用Windows2000以上的版本或Windows XP版本2. 采用计算机管理不但可以提高工作效率,而且还可以节省人力、物力、财力,这样原来几个人干的工作现在一个人就完全可以胜任。因此单从节省的

7、职工工资、提高工作效率而避免各种直接或间接的经济损失角度来看,该系统实际所能够起到的作用将会远远大于投入的开发费用,所以从经济上是完全可行的。3. 开发所采用的工具是MyEclipse,开发出的应用程序均是图形化界面,操作员几乎不用记住任何DOS命令就可以直接操作此软件。另外,软件的操作员大多已经会基本的Windows操作,即便不会操作Windows,经过短期的培训也能熟练地使用本软件,所以在操作上也是可行的。4. 本系统经过精心设计开发,比较紧凑,项目比较小,所以对软硬的要求并不高,运行投入也相对较少,现在普通的电脑都能够满足条件,因此,本系统在运行上是可行的。1.5 系统功能需求分析1.5

8、.1 系统的基本要求 进销存系统必须提供顾客信息、厂家信息、采购信息、销售信息、库存信息和财务信息的基础设计:提供强大的精确查找和模糊查找信息的功能,可以分不同权限、不同用户对该系统进行操作。另外,该系统还必须保证数据的安全性、完整性和准确性。超市进销存管理系统的目标是实现超市信息化管理,减少盲目采购、降低采购成本、合理控制库存、减少资金占用并提升超市综合竞争力。时间就是金钱,效率就是生命。超市进销存管理系统能够为超市节省大量人力资源,减少管理费用,从而间接为超市节约成本,提高超市效率。通过与超市人员进行交流,发现超市管理系统需要满足来自多个不同用户的要求。在超市经营中,按照人员的职能分为五大

9、类,分别是顾客、营业员、采购员、经理、系统管理员。1.5.2 系统的基本功能通过与管理人员进行反复的讨论,最终确定系统应该实现以下功能:1.对商品信息的变动进行处理在商品的采购和销售过程中,商品信息总是在不断变化的,比如商品价格的调整、商品信息的修改、新商品信息的增加以及旧商品信息的删除,因此设计系统时必须考虑到这些情况。商品信息有商品编号、商品名、商品数量、商品规格、商品价格、厂家名等属性。2.对用户信息的变动进行处理需考虑到职员的雇佣和解雇、所以用户信息的修改及删除也是要有的。3. 对采购信息的变动进行处理采购员在采购的过程中采购信息也在不断发生改变,因此也要充分考虑。采购信息有采购编号、

10、采购日期、商品厂家、采购员、商品价格、商品规格、商品数量等属性。4. 对销售信息的变动进行处理营业员在销售的过程中销售信息也在不断发生改变,如顾客买到了劣质产品要求退货,因此也要充分考虑。5. 查询及统计功能要求可以根据指定的条件对厂家信息、顾客信息、商品信息、采购信息、销售信息进行查询和对每天账务的收入支出进行统计查询!查询又分为精确查询和模糊查询。1.5.3系统总用例及用例分析(UML)1.5.4 系统主要功能模块的系统时序图/活动图/1.6 系统非功能需求分析 为了能当超市增加新的业务需求时能方便的升级系统,所以系统应当具有良好的扩张性。也需要能够与第三方产品对接,比如:与短信平台对接以

11、提供短信发送和接收功能。与声讯系统对接,提供自动呼叫服务。与邮件系统对接以发送和接受邮件。1.6.1 硬件环境标准设备:PC机辅助设备:扫描仪,打印机等为了达到快速浏览 页面,及时响应必要的页面操作的要求,要求客户端配置如下:n 操作系统 win2000 及以上n Cpu 主频500M及以上n 最小内存 128MB 内存n 最小磁盘空间 20GB 最小磁盘空间n 上网能力 宽带上网1.6.2 软件环境系统开发工具: MyEclipse系统开发语言:java 、jsp 、struts 2、 hibernate。数据库管理系统软件:MySQL。运行平台:Windows XP。分辨率:最佳效果1024*768像素。

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 应用文书 > 财经金融

本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

工信部备案号:黑ICP备15003705号© 2020-2023 www.taowenge.com 淘文阁